The shabby appearance of the boys along with the hard work they put in, hides the fact that they were used to better times in their past. Their maturity makes one forget the fact that they are little boys of twelve and eleven. When boys of their age would be playing and having fun, these two shine shoes, sell the newspaper and do all kinds of odd jobs. If we think that all this is to earn their living, we are again wrong, because it is for the sake of their sister. The young age and the frail body are a facade to their inner strength.
This deceptive appearance must have helped them in their role as secret messengers against the German troops. Thus we see that the boys prove again and again that appearances are deceptive. However, amidst this facade, the earnestness of the boys shines through their eyes and there is no deception in that.
